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Tunis to Agrigento is to car ferry and bus which costs €50 - €70 and takes 15h 10m.
The fastest way to get from Tunis to Agrigento is to fly and train which takes 6h 42m and costs €130 - €320.
The distance between Tunis and Agrigento is 471 km.
The best way to get from Tunis to Agrigento without a car is to car ferry and train which takes 14h 59m and costs €55 - €90.
It takes approximately 6h 42m to get from Tunis to Agrigento, including transfers.

What companies run services between Tunis, Tunisia and Agrigento, Italy?
There is no direct connection from Tunis to Agrigento. However, you can take the line 635 bus to Aeroport Carthage, walk to Tunis (TUN) airport, fly to Palermo Airport (PMO), walk to Palermo Aeroporto, then take the train to Agrigento Centrale. Alternatively, you can take a vehicle from Tunis to Agrigento via Port of Tunis and Port of Palermo in around 12h 23m.
